Rated 5 out of 5 stars

Can I give more than 5 stars?

It is safe to say Matt & Joe are some of the most legit, knowledgeable & respected people in the online marketing space. I have listened to every podcast episode they have done (hustle & flowchart podcast), I am a member of their online community & have purchased many of their products as well as a few things they recommend. If it wasn't for these guys my business would still be struggling. Pay no attention to the lower star reviews, some people just have no idea. Thanks for everything guys, keep doing what you are doing.

Hi Karen Hanover (and others who might see this),

It's unfortunate that this situation needed to happen. After purchasing our training, Perpetual Audience Growth, Karen decided that she needed to do a chargeback with her bank to refund the funds she invested.

After seeing a notification of this chargeback, I (Joe Fier), immediately emailed Karen to ask why and if there's a way to help her out (she never emailed or messaged us in any form prior to this point).

Here is my first email to her and her reply (it started very nice): https://cl.ly/2b46b4f2ca71 & https://cl.ly/7d5df3f52aac

As you can see here, Karen meant no harm to our business, so I thought we were looking good!

I informed her of our refund policy. Typically we don't offer refunds (because it's simple to steal any digital products and we offer one-on-one time & guidance to each customer), but because she said she has no more time to spend on this, we immediately gave her a full refund.

After asking Karen to remove the chargeback request and asking for proof that she's done so (protocol from any bank), she began blowing up at me in email and yelling that we are wasting her time and she should have left the dispute. See here: https://cl.ly/e2310b689ac5

That is the full story as to why Karen posted this review.

So long story short: Please don't take Karen's comment at face value. Unfortunately, some customers forget that there is a business and real people on the other side of a computer who have been in business for 12 years and genuinely want to help people.

This is the only communication we've ever had with her, we offered all the support she allowed us to give, and still, we were met with "they will treat you like a dog and ban you" sentiments. Ugh.
